Output 43631aaffc1879d4d796c2a41d28ddf368e6659b00e67cdab255a700f2c99893:0

value
5625514
script pubkey
OP_0 OP_PUSHBYTES_20 311619a16545e5c44400536e7203a75b2718aebd
address
bc1qxytpngt9ghjug3qq2dh8yqa8tvn33t4a9e6ruv
transaction
43631aaffc1879d4d796c2a41d28ddf368e6659b00e67cdab255a700f2c99893
spent
true